2015-05-08 8 views

risposta

10

Secondo this post, è del formato

IP1:PORT1,IP2:PORT2,...,IPn:PORTn 

. Ad esempio:

127.0.0.1:2181,127.0.0.1:2182,127.0.0.1:2183,127.0.0.1:2184 
+2

Uno di le peggiori istanze di "tutto è documentato, ma la documentazione non ti dice nulla" che ho visto in una API pubblica. Ho continuato a seguire la fonte attraverso vari metodi di costruzione e alla fine fino a quando non sono arrivato a FixedEnsembleProvider e ho rinunciato, senza dadi. È solo "la stringa di connessione" in ogni Javadoc fino in fondo. – mpontes

+0

Accetto. Molto noioso. – Ztyx

1

curatore, un client API per Apache Zookeeper quindi la risposta completamente documentata a questo è disponibile nella Zookeeper Javadocs: Zookeeper Javadocs

connectString - separate da virgole ospitanti: coppie di porte, ciascuna corrispondente a un server zk. per esempio. "127.0.0.1:3000,127.0.0.1:3001,127.0.0.1:3002" Se viene utilizzato il suffisso chroot facoltativo, l'esempio sarà simile a "127.0.0.1:3000,127.0.0.1:3001,127.0.0.1:3002/app/a "dove il client sarebbe rootato a"/app/a "e tutti i percorsi sarebbero relativi a questa radice - cioè ottenere/impostare/etc ..."/foo/bar "